#b77d5f - Silken Chocolate color

This rich, earthy terracotta blends warm cinnamon brown with a soft, muted coral-pink, creating a cozy, sunbaked tone. It reads as both grounded and slightly rosy, evoking autumn leaves, weathered leather, and clay pottery. In interiors or textiles it brings rustic elegance and intimate warmth without feeling overpowering. It pairs beautifully with cream, olive green, deep navy, and brass accents, and suits palettes that aim for inviting, natural sophistication with a subtle vintage character.

color #b77d5f

#b77d5f color RGB value is 183, 125, 95, and the CMYK value is 0.00, 0.317, 0.481, 0.282. Alternative names for that color are: silken chocolate, tan, darksalmon, antique brass, sepia, orange.
